Back in the 1990's, the Western Pennsylvania Conservancy held a fund raising campaign to repair Fallingwater. One of the punchlines in the campaign was that engineering technology had finally caught-up with Frank Lloyd Wright's design genius. Specifically, the technology for the internal supports for the cantilevered decks, that would last for longer than a few decades, was invented.
